Key Buying Factors for Employee Time Clocks Without Monthly Fees
Authentication Methods
Choose fingerprint, RFID, PIN, face recognition, or a hybrid system based on your workplace. Biometric options help reduce buddy punching, while PIN and card support can be useful for backup access.
Setup and Daily Use
Look for a system your staff can learn quickly. Fast connection, guided app control, and clear menus matter more than flashy extras if you want adoption across shifts.
Reporting and Payroll Export
Even without monthly fees, a good time clock should still make payroll easier. Helpful reports include attendance summaries, overtime, late arrivals, and break tracking so managers spend less time cleaning up timesheets.
Rules, Shifts, and Scheduling
If your team works rotating shifts or has overtime rules, pick a model that supports custom schedules, lunch breaks, and flexible attendance policies. These features are especially valuable for growing businesses.
Connectivity and Data Access
Some Employee Time Clocks Without Monthly Fees store data locally, while others add app or cloud access for remote monitoring. Local systems may be simpler, but cloud or app control can save time for managers overseeing multiple locations.
Who Should Buy Which Employee Time Clocks Without Monthly Fees?
Small offices and shops that only need dependable punch-in tracking can usually start with a basic fingerprint, PIN, or card-based model. Businesses with shift work, overtime rules, or multiple managers should consider app-connected systems with stronger reporting. If you want remote visibility and easier oversight, cloud-enabled options are the best fit. The right choice comes down to how much automation you need now and how likely your attendance process is to grow later.
